    The Miele Blizzard CX1 PureSuction is distinguished by its bagless design and advanced Vortex technology, making it a strong choice for users who prefer minimal maintenance and high filtration efficiency. Its 1200W motor combined with the Hygiene Lifetime filter can capture 99.98% of fine particles, outperforming bagged models like the Miele Classic C1 in fine dust retention. The inclusion of two floorheads—Parquet Twister and AllTeQ—adds versatility, especially for delicate surfaces. However, its bulkier build can make quick maneuvering in tight spaces more challenging compared to smaller, more streamlined models like the Miele Classic C1. Ideal for users prioritizing low-maintenance, high filtration, and bagless convenience.

Factors to Consider When Choosing Miele Vacuum Cleaners

When choosing a Miele vacuum cleaner, it’s important to consider not just specifications but how well the model fits your cleaning routine, home environment, and personal preferences. Understanding these factors helps prevent overspending on features you won’t use or ending up with a model that doesn’t perform as expected.

Type of Vacuum: Canister vs. Upright vs. Stick

Canister models like the Miele Blizzard CX1 offer great maneuverability and are typically lighter to carry, making them ideal for stairs and multi-surface homes. Upright vacuums, often bulkier, can be more suited for quick, deep cleans of large areas but may be cumbersome for tight spaces. Stick vacuums are perfect for quick pickups and small tasks but might lack the power for deep cleaning or handling pet hair. Consider your home layout and cleaning frequency when choosing the type that will work best for you.

Filtration Technology

Many Miele models feature HEPA filters or AirClean systems, which are essential for allergy sufferers or homes with pets. These filters trap fine dust and allergens, improving indoor air quality. However, high-end filtration systems often come with higher replacement costs and maintenance requirements. Balancing filtration quality with affordability and ease of maintenance is key—look for models where filter replacement and cleaning are straightforward.

Suction Power and Cleaning Performance

Suction strength varies across models, impacting how well they pick up dirt, pet hair, and debris. More powerful vacuums like the Blizzard CX1 series excel at deep cleaning carpets and stubborn pet hair. However, higher power settings can lead to increased noise and energy consumption. Consider your typical cleaning needs—if you mostly clean hard floors, a less powerful but quieter model might suffice. For carpets and pets, prioritize models with stronger suction and specialized attachments.

Ease of Use and Convenience Features

Features such as adjustable suction, ergonomic handles, and lightweight design improve usability. Cord length and cord management also affect convenience, especially in larger homes. Some models include LED lights for better visibility in dark corners, or automatic cord rewind for hassle-free storage. Think about how often and how long you clean—these details can significantly impact your experience and satisfaction with the vacuum.

Accessories and Versatility

Attachments like pet hair tools, crevice nozzles, and upholstery brushes expand a vacuum’s versatility. Miele models often come with several accessories, but their usefulness depends on your specific cleaning needs. For homes with pets, a model with a dedicated pet hair tool makes a noticeable difference. Also, consider whether the vacuum can handle different surfaces—hard floors, carpets, and specialty areas—without needing multiple devices. Well-chosen accessories can extend the lifespan and utility of your vacuum.

Frequently Asked Questions

Are Miele vacuum cleaners suitable for allergy sufferers?

Many Miele models feature HEPA or AirClean filters that trap allergens and fine dust, making them a strong choice for allergy sufferers. Their sealed systems prevent dust from escaping back into the air during cleaning, which is particularly helpful for those with respiratory sensitivities. However, regular filter replacement and maintenance are necessary to maintain optimal filtration performance, so it’s worth choosing models with accessible filter access and clear maintenance instructions.

How do I choose between a bagged and bagless Miele vacuum?

Bagged models generally offer better filtration and are less messy to empty, which can be advantageous for those with allergies or asthma. They also tend to have a longer lifespan since bags can be replaced more easily than filters in some bagless models. Conversely, bagless models save money over time since you don’t need to buy replacement bags, but emptying the bin can release dust into the air if not done carefully. Your choice depends on your priorities—convenience versus filtration and hygiene.

Are Miele vacuums difficult to maintain?

Miele vacuums are designed with durability and ease of maintenance in mind, but regular upkeep is necessary to keep them performing well. Replacing filters and bags, cleaning brushes, and checking for blockages are common tasks. Models with clear access panels and simple filter replacement processes tend to be easier to maintain. Investing a few minutes regularly extends the lifespan of your vacuum and preserves its cleaning power, making routine maintenance well worth it.

Which Miele vacuum is best for pet owners?

For pet owners, models like the Blizzard CX1 Cat & Dog or the Guard M1 Cat & Dog stand out because they feature powerful suction, specialized pet hair tools, and filtration systems designed to handle dander and fur. These models excel at capturing stubborn pet hair on carpets and furniture, reducing allergen buildup. Keep in mind, pet-focused vacuums often come with extra accessories, so consider whether those features justify their higher price point for your household needs.

Should I opt for a cordless Miele stick vacuum or a traditional canister?

Cordless Miele stick vacuums offer unmatched portability and quick cleanups, making them ideal for small tasks or homes without extensive flooring. However, they usually have shorter battery life and less suction power compared to traditional canister models. Canister vacuums like the Blizzard CX1 provide more consistent performance for deep cleaning and larger areas but require a power outlet and more storage space. Your decision should depend on how often and how thoroughly you plan to clean, as well as your home’s size and layout.
